Episode 20 of 30, Antiques Roadshow, Series 33
Duration: 59 minutes
Fiona Bruce and the team visit the National History Museum of Wales at St Fagans, just outside Cardiff. Amongst the objects catching the eyes of the specialists are a collection of early dog collars, and a doll gifted by Queen Mary as a thank you after she took tea in a miners cottage. Plus, veteran ceramics specialist Henry Sandon reveals which one antque object he would most wish to find.
